From 90b9c22c706eec3fb5b4322f5a445a8fc2a79536 Mon Sep 17 00:00:00 2001 From: Willi Braun Date: Thu, 15 Feb 2018 07:57:58 +0100 Subject: [PATCH] [BE] added size and range operator to diff module Belonging to [master]: - OpenModelica/OMCompiler#2203 - OpenModelica/OpenModelica-testsuite#856 --- Compiler/BackEnd/Differentiate.mo |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/Compiler/BackEnd/Differentiate.mo b/Compiler/BackEnd/Differentiate.mo index 00aa0329f34..ff94f5b379c 100644 --- a/Compiler/BackEnd/Differentiate.mo +++ b/Compiler/BackEnd/Differentiate.mo @@ -717,6 +717,12 @@ algorithm case DAE.LUNARY() then (inExp, inFunctionTree); + case DAE.SIZE() + then (inExp, inFunctionTree); + + case DAE.RANGE() + then (inExp, inFunctionTree); + else equation true = Flags.isSet(Flags.FAILTRACE); s1 = ExpressionDump.printExpStr(inExp);